Lina vs Lindal
American parents have registered 19,494 Linas since 1880, against 35 Lindals. Lina is still ahead, with 527 babies in 2025.

Who was ahead
Lina has been the commoner name in every year either was published, 1880 to 2025. The lead has never changed hands.
The closest they came was 1942, when Lina had 53 and Lindal had 11.

Which name is older
Half of the Lindals alive today are over 82; half the Linas are over 19. That is 63 years between them: two names in use at the same time, worn by two different generations.
